The Future of the United Kingdom: Unity or Division?

The nation of the United Kingdom right now stands at a pivotal juncture, facing a complex question: will it remain unified, or succumb to deepening division? Latest events, like Brexit and the growing calls for Scottish independence, have underscored pre-existing cracks within the historic union. Some believe that a renewed priority on shared beliefs, alongside financial funding in deprived regions, could solidify bonds and foster a sense of shared goal. However, others argue that the entrenched governmental disagreements and cultural identities are unbridgeable, and that the long-term of the UK as a unified entity are more and more uncertain. The course of the UK depends on the choices made by politicians and citizens alike, and the potential to navigate these significant challenges.
